    What is battery acid

    Battery acid is a common name for sulfuric acid, a mineral acid used in lead-acid batteries. Learn about the chemical properties, concentration, and reactions of battery acid, as well as its sources and safety precautions. A lead-acid battery consists of two lead plates separated by a liquid or gel containing sulfuric acid in water. The battery is rechargeable, with charging and discharging chemical. When the battery is fully charged, the negative plate is lead, the electrolyte is concentrated sulfuric acid, and the positive plate is lead dioxide. If the.     Tunisia's Ministry of Industry, Mines, and Energy has invited bids to develop a 300 MW solar power project with a 150 MW/540 MWh battery energy storage system. The project will be developed under a concession agreement on a 440-hectare plot of land in Bazma, Kebili governorate. The 'Bazma-Kébili photovoltaic.
